High Voltage Programmable DC Power Supplies come in different types, including Single-Output, Dual-Output, and Multiple-Output variants. The Single-Output type offers simplicity and cost-effectiveness, making it ideal for basic applications. The Dual-Output type provides versatility by offering two independently controlled outputs, catering to more complex testing requirements. The Multiple-Output type offers even greater flexibility with multiple outputs, perfect for advanced testing and development tasks. High Voltage Programmable DC Power Supplies find various applications across different industries:

Semiconductor: Used for testing semiconductor devices, ensuring accurate voltage and current supply for performance evaluations.

Automotive: Utilized in electric vehicle charging stations and battery testing to provide precise voltage and current for efficient performance.

Industrial: Employed in power electronics testing, calibration, and efficiency testing of industrial equipment.

Others: Used in research laboratories, aerospace industry, and medical equipment testing.

The fastest-growing application segment in terms of revenue is the automotive industry. This rapid growth is driven by the increasing demand for electric vehicles, leading to a higher requirement for high voltage programmable DC power supplies for battery testing and charging stations.
